United Arab Emirates Ministry of Artificial Intelligence

The year 2017 marked a decisive turning point for the UAE with the creation of the Ministry of Artificial Intelligence, the first initiative of its kind in the world, reflecting the UAE's ambition to anchor itself in the future. Under the enlightened leadership of His Excellency Omar Sultan Al Olama, the Ministry has rapidly established itself as an engine of transformation, not only for Dubai but for the UAE as a whole. His Excellency's appointment in 2020 as Minister of State for Artificial Intelligence, the Digital Economy and Telework broadened the Ministry's scope, underlining the strategic importance of these areas for the country.

Innovations and Key Achievements

Under the banner of this ministry, the UAE has launched several pioneering projects that use AI to optimize government services, health, education and safety. The integration of AI into Dubai's traffic and public transport is a perfect example, improving efficiency and reducing congestion in this ever-growing metropolis. In addition, the Ministry has played a crucial role in the conceptualization and implementation of the National AI Strategy, aiming to position the UAE as a global leader in AI by 2031.

Positioning the Emirates as a global technology leader

The UAE's ambition is not limited to the adoption of AI; it encompasses a broader vision to become the global hub for technological innovation. His Excellency Omar Sultan Al Olama 's role in promoting the digital economy and teleworking highlights the country's efforts to create an environment conducive to innovation and entrepreneurship. The Dubai Future Foundation and the World Government Summit, of which His Excellency is a board member and CEO respectively, are examples of this innovative dynamic.
